استخدامات SYSDIFF /INF تنسيق عشري للحصول على قيم REG_DWORD

هام: تمت ترجمة هذا المقال باستخدام برنامج ترجمة آلية لشركة مايكروسوفت بدلاً من الاستعانة بمترجم بشري. تقدم شركة مايكروسوفت كلاً من المقالات المترجمة بواسطة المترجمين البشر والمقالات المترجمة آليًا وبالتالي ستتمكن من الوصول إلى كل المقالات الموجودة في قاعدة المعرفة الخاصة بنا وباللغة الخاصة بك. بالرغم من ذلك، فإن المقالة المترجمة آليًا لا تكون دقيقة دائمًا وقد تحتوي على أخطاء إملائية أو لغوية أو نحوية، مثل تلك الأخطاء الصادرة عن متحدث أجنبي عندما يتحدث بلغتك. لا تتحمل شركة مايكروسوفت مسئولية عدم الدقة أو الأخطاء أو الضرر الناتج عن أية أخطاء في ترجمة المحتوى أو استخدامه من قبل عملائنا. تعمل شركة مايكروسوفت باستمرار على ترقية برنامج الترجمة الآلية

اضغط هنا لرابط المقالة باللغة الانجليزية197161
تمت أرشفة هذه المقالة. وتظهر "كما هي" ولن يتم تحديثها بعد الآن.
الأعراض
عند إنشاء ملف .inf من حزمة SYSDIFF ستكون قيم التسجيل في الحزمة 0 بعد تشغيل الملف .inf عندما تكون القيمة في ملف .inf أكبر من 2147483647.
السبب
عند كتابة إدخال تسجيل المتضمنة في ملف إضافية إلى ملف .inf باستخدام بناء الجملة /INF SYSDIFF تتم كتابة قيم REG_DWORD في نموذج العشري. على سبيل المثال، يُكتب 0x80000010 2147483664.

عند تشغيل Setupapi.dll هذا الملف .inf يتحقق ما إذا كانت قيم REG_DWORD عشرية يتجاوز 2147483647 وكتابة 0 إلى التسجيل. يتحقق SETUPAPI القيمة لأنه يتم كافة قيم عشرية من المفترض أن تكون موقعة أعداد صحيحة و ولذلك، يحدث حدث تجاوز.
الحل
لحل هذه المشكلة، يجب الحصول على أحدث حزمة خدمة لـ Windows NT 4.0 أو تحديث البرنامج الفردية. للحصول على معلومات حول كيفية الحصول على أحدث حزمة خدمة الرجاء الانتقال إلى:
للحصول على معلومات حول كيفية الحصول على تحديث البرنامج الفردية الاتصال بخدمات دعم منتجات Microsoft. للحصول على قائمة كاملة بأرقام الهاتف خدمات دعم منتجات Microsoft وعلى معلومات حول تكاليف الدعم، الرجاء الانتقال إلى العنوان التالي على الويب:
تصريح
أقرت Microsoft أن هذه مشكلة في نظام التشغيل Windows NT 4.0. تم تصحيح هذه المشكلة لأول مرة في Windows NT الإصدار 4.0 Service Pack 5.
4.00

تحذير: تمت ترجمة هذه المقالة تلقائيًا

خصائص

رقم الموضوع: 197161 - آخر مراجعة: 02/07/2014 05:49:34 - المراجعة: 1.5

Microsoft Windows NT Workstation 4.0 Developer Edition, Microsoft Windows NT Server 4.0 Standard Edition

  • kbnosurvey kbarchive kbmt kbhotfixserver kbqfe kbbug kbfix kbqfe KB197161 KbMtar
تعليقات
ERROR: at System.Diagnostics.Process.Kill() at Microsoft.Support.SEOInfrastructureService.PhantomJS.PhantomJSRunner.WaitForExit(Process process, Int32 waitTime, StringBuilder dataBuilder, Boolean isTotalProcessTimeout)